Job Responsibilities

  • Assist innovation engineer to design, prototype, and test new products.
  • Explore innovative materials, production methods, and tooling solutions to enhance product performance, functionality, and manufacturability.
  • Support pilot runs and prototype builds to validate new product designs and manufacturing approaches.
  • Create and refine CAD models, layouts, drafting documentation and schematics for new products and experimental production setups.
  • Work with sales team to produce technical drawings for manufacturing and production teams.
  • Collect and analyze data from prototype testing and small-scale production to inform design improvements and product iterations.
  • Contribute to ideation sessions, product design reviews, and cross-functional innovation workshops.
  • Assist in documenting product development experiments, prototype results, and lessons learned to accelerate future projects.
  • Work closely with quality, sales and production teams to translate innovative ideas into scalable, manufacturable products.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in mechanical engineering or related field.
  • Strong interest in product design, prototyping and hands-on experimentation.
  • Creative problem-solver with a curiosity for materials, manufacturing technologies and new product possibilities.
  • Experience with CAD software (AutoCAD or SolidWorks).
  • Internship or co-op experience in manufacturing or production engineering.
  • Ability to read technical drawings, schematics, and engineering documentation.
  • Comfortable working in an iterative, fast-moving product development environment.
